Abstract

See full text

The invention provides a bearing including an inner bearing surface that is formed by a layer of self-lubricating material and that contains axially extending and circumferentially spaced apart lubrication grooves. The inner bearing surface and the grooves therein are formed by conforming the self-lubricating material to the outer surface of a mandrel that has elongated members supported thereon so that the elongated members form the lubrication grooves. An overlayment is then applied on the layer of self-lubricating material, the overlayment including a plurality of filaments wound around the layer of self-lubricating material, and a hardenable liquid to bond the layer of self-lubricating material to the overlayment.
